I don't think that the iPod Classic and iPod touch are designed to cater to the same market. The Classic is for the people who still like the click wheel, and have a massive library of music. The iPod touch is seemingly designed to cater to the market that wants a multifuction device, which is seen in the fact that it has Safari and Youtube.
